I applied online. The process took 4 days. I interviewed at State Farm in Dec 2023
Interview
The interview process was pretty standard. You do the assessment which is super easy. Then you have a HireVue interview that asks 7 questions. If you’re good with interviews, you should do well. I checked the status of my application and it said “reviewed: not selected” so I’m assuming I did not get the role (haven’t received an email yet). Overall, I think it was a great experience. I would recommend others to apply.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Tell me a time you had to make a difficult decision, tell me about yourself and why you chose State Farm, a time you dealt with a difficult customer, how do you adapt to change, and tell me something competitive that’ll make you stand out.
I applied online. I interviewed at State Farm (Dunwoody, GA)
Interview
Virtual recorded interview is first after passing typing test. Second, interview is with an HR Rep. It is not a full interview but giving an over view of the position and expectations. After that is discussed, you are asked if the job is something you are still interested in. Offers are sent in writing.
I first received a 7 question hirevue video interview. I didn't hear back after 2 weeks so I responded with one of the emails with a follow up. A day later I received an email for "candidate conversation" which was very relaxed. After that I had an interview with two questions regarding claim processing and was offered the job the next day.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
A question regarding how would I handle a claim where claimant was not providing documents for a claim.
